阿里云国际站:asp.net 显示数据库字段

要在 ASP.NET 中显示数据库字段,可以使用以下步骤:

  1. 首先,在页面代码中添加一个 GridView 控件。可以使用 Visual Studio 的可视化设计器或手动编写 HTML 代码。
  2. 接着,需要在代码中指定 GridView 控件的数据源。可以使用以下代码:
GridView1.DataSource = myDataSet.Tables[0]; // myDataSet 是 DataSet 类型的数据集
GridView1.DataBind();

这里的 myDataSet.Tables[0] 表示数据集中的第一个表格。如果需要使用其他表格,可以将 [0] 改为该表格的索引号或名称。

  1. 最后,在 GridView 控件中指定需要显示的字段。可以使用以下代码:
<asp:BoundField DataField="字段名" HeaderText="表头名" />

其中,DataField 属性指定字段名,HeaderText 属性指定表头名。

例如,如果要显示数据库中的员工姓名、电子邮件和职务,则可以使用以下代码:

<asp:GridView ID="GridView1" runat="server">
  <Columns>
    <asp:BoundField DataField="EmpName" HeaderText="员工姓名" />
    <asp:BoundField DataField="Email" HeaderText="电子邮件" />
    <asp:BoundField DataField="Position" HeaderText="职务" />
  </Columns>
</asp:GridView>

要在ASP.NET中显示数据库字段,您可以使用以下步骤:

1.创建一个数据库连接:在代码中创建一个数据库连接对象,以便从数据库中检索所需的信息。您可以使用ADO.NET提供的方法来连接数据库。

2.查询数据库:使用SQL查询语言,您可以编写代码来检索所需的数据。例如,您可以使用“SELECT”语句从数据库中检索记录。

阿里云国际站:asp.net 显示数据库字段

3.将数据绑定到网格视图或其他控件:您可以使用ASP.NET中的各种控件,如GridView,Repeater或DataList,将数据绑定到网格或其他控件中。这使您可以轻松地呈现数据,并让用户与数据进行交互。

以下是一个示例代码,可以通过查询数据库中的记录,并将它们绑定到网格视图中:

using System;
using System.Data.SqlClient;
using System.Web.Configuration;
using System.Web.UI;
using System.Web.UI.WebControls;

public partial class Default : System.Web.UI.Page
{
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            string connectionString = WebCon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String;
            using (SqlConnection connection = new SqlConnection(connectionString))
            {
                connection.Open();
                SqlCommand command = new SqlCommand("SELECT * FROM Customers", connection);
                SqlDataReader reader = command.ExecuteReader();
                CustomerGridView.DataSource = reader;
                CustomerGridView.DataBind();
                reader.Close();
            }
        }
    }
}

在此示例代码中,我们首先创建了一个数据库连接对象,并使用“Open()”方法打开它。然后,我们使用“SELECT”语句查询“Customers”表中的所有记录,并使用“ExecuteReader()”方法执行查询。最后,我们将结果绑定到名为“CustomerGridView”的GridView控件中,并使用“DataBind()”方法将其呈现给用户。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/158993.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月10日 05:59
下一篇 2024年3月10日 06:16

相关推荐

  • 阿里云计算公司名单

    国内云计算公司有哪些? 云计算公司现在都是大企业在玩,小企业根本玩不动啊!阿里云 百度云 360云等 做云计算的有哪些公司? 做云计算的公司很多,国家工业“十二五”规划提出“十区百企”的目标,就是物联网行业要在全国建10个集中区,力挺100个企业走上规模,可见政府的支持力度是很大的。阿里云 百度 中兴 多了去了,国际上的有微软 IBM 等等。这是个新兴产业,…

    2023年8月27日
    15300
  • 阿里云国际站注册教程:阿里云通过终端怎管理

    要在终端中管理阿里云(Aliyun),你需要使用阿里云的命令行工具,即 Alibaba Cloud CLI(命令行接口)。这个工具可以让你通过终端或命令提示符窗口管理你的云资源。下面是一个基本的步骤指南,帮助你开始使用 Alibaba Cloud CLI: 安装 CLI 工具: 你需要先安装 Python 和 pip(Python 包管理器)。 通过 pip…

    2024年7月5日
    13500
  • 惠州阿里云代理商:阿里云控制台

    惠州的阿里云代理商可以帮助您在使用阿里云控制台方面提供相关的技术指导和支持。 阿里云控制台是阿里云提供的一个在线管理平台,用户可以通过该控制台进行云产品的购买、资源管理、配置调整、监控和安全管理等操作。通过阿里云控制台,您可以轻松地管理您的云服务,进行资源部署和配置,以及对云服务器、数据库、存储和网络等进行监控和管理。 作为一家阿里云代理商,我们可以为您提供…

    2023年12月25日
    15800
  • 临沂阿里云代理商:按量计费ecs

    阿里云是中国领先的云计算服务提供商,提供了丰富的云计算产品和服务。其中,ECS(Elastic Compute Service)是阿里云的一项核心产品,提供弹性计算能力。 按量计费是ECS的一种计费方式,与包年包月计费相对。按量计费意味着用户只需根据实际使用的资源量付费,按小时计费。这种计费方式灵活方便,适用于对资源需求有较大波动的场景。 作为临沂的阿里云代…

    2024年1月27日
    17500
  • 苏州阿里云代理商:阿里云 日志

    作为苏州阿里云的代理商,我们为客户提供阿里云日志服务。阿里云日志服务是一种稳定、高效的日志收集、存储、查询和分析服务,能够帮助企业实时监控和分析海量日志数据。 阿里云日志服务具有以下特点: 强大的日志收集能力:支持各种应用、服务器、容器等产生的日志收集,提供丰富的SDK和API接口,方便接入和配置。 高可靠性和可扩展性:采用分布式架构,支持TB级别的日志数据…

    2024年2月2日
    19300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/